The speed to beat is 262.8 MPH

Based on my testings today , I can tell 262.8 mph will be the Enzo's final speed (max speed) ran on the 10km straith. (unless someone happens to find some suspension gimmick / the game physics change again)

My best results were 423.0 km/h / 262.8 mph ~550 meters before finish line.

Then 262.9 mph / 423.1 km/h with reversing for huge startin speeds ( 418.0 km/h / 259.7 mph)
Going up that last decimal took about 3km of even road surface.

And at that downhill the speeds got as high as 429 km/h + / 266 mph +

On it's own the Enzo can hold/ stay at over 423 km/h / 262.9x mph

Since the Stage3 Turbo is for higher RPM, wouldn this be the SetUp for HighSpeed?? Why is the Stage2 Setup getting higher Speeds???
Apologies, I should have addressed this one earlier. It's mostly down to the delivery of power and the gearing that's involved with these kind of speeds. When you're changing gear with a longer geared box you'll often end up shifting into a lower torque zone in the engine's ability on a stage 3 turbo setup, therefore you'll get a more sluggish power delivery. Because the stage 2 turbo has more power towards the middle of the rev range it'll work more efficiently towards the top speeds.
It's also sometimes the case that the lower spec turbo has a higher output to begin with, such as with the SRT4, A little over 600bhp from a stg 3 turbo, but 613 from the stg 2. (I think also the SL55 or 65 is like this too, only hitting the 1000bhp with the stg 2 and around 980 on a stg 3)
